Munich's oldest seat of power (13th c.) and former imperial residence — right in the heart of the old town.
The Alter Hof is Munich's oldest surviving seat of power, built as a ducal fortress in the late 12th century. From 1255 it served as the residence of the Dukes of Upper Bavaria and briefly functioned as an imperial palace under Ludwig the Bavarian. The sprawling complex — comprising several wings and courtyards — survived centuries of urban growth around it. Today it houses government offices alongside a small museum on Wittelsbach history, while the courtyard invites visitors to step into Munich's medieval core.
